Amazing Blackpool Illuminations
Blackpool Illuminations is one of England's biggest light festivals, founded over a century ago in 1879.
The celebration stretches from the Central Promenade north to Bispham, with over one million lightbulbs being switched on annually by a famous face. Arriving early is your best chance of avoiding substantial queues.
You will also be able to find yourself the best spot to watch all of the brilliantly lit floats and trams travelling up and down the coastal road. A stage is also built for the ceremonial switching of the illuminations, which is then given to pop stars to entertain the celebrating crowds.

Walking the River Ribble
A 25-minute drive south from the centre of Blackpool is the Ribble Estuary Nature Reserve, where the River Ribble runs into the sea. Here, you will find a stunning series of coastal marshes and natural habitats popular for ramblers, walkers, and birdwatchers alike.
After a walk through the rugged nature of Northern England, a brief trip further south will bring you to Churchtown, where you can find affordable refreshment in one of their quaint village pubs.
Blackpool's Nightlife
Blackpool is notable as one of the favourite destinations for hen and stag parties. The coastal resort has a wide variety of nighttime entertainment to entice any would-be visitor.
The Grand Theatre, located near the Winter Gardens, is a stunning Victorian theatre that hosts plays, comedy and dance performances for everyone to enjoy. If cabaret is more your style, then Viva is the place for you, with its colourful theatre hosting several pubs and bars.
On the other hand, clubbers will want to head over to Flamingo, one of the largest clubs in Blackpool and noted for its star DJ sets.
